Sirius A is a type A1V star so has a colour of Blue White -> Blue. Sirius B is a white dwarf. Wiki User. steiner atlantic partsWebJul 3, 2024 · The true color of Sirius is blue-white, and it is described so by other authors at the same times. Astrophysically, there is virtually no chance that Sirius has radically changed its color in the last couple thousand years. This probably reflects not on the evolution of the star, but on the evolution of language. steiner back spot faceWebDec 5, 2024 · Sirius, the brightest star in the night sky.
